As of 2010-2014, the total population of 55041 Zip Code is 7,586, which is 1.66% more than it was in 2000. The population growth rate is much lower than the state average rate of 9.44% and is much lower than the national average rate of 11.61%. The 55041 Zip Code population density is 47.79 people per square mile, which is lower than the state average density of 61.93 people per square mile and is lower than the national average density of 82.73 people per square mile. The most prevalent race in 55041 Zip Code is white, which represent 98.58% of the total population. The average 55041 Zip Code education level is lower than the state average and is about the same as the national average.
